Nissin Food Products. Japan: To-Go Dam Project

Nissin, a food brand, increased sales in Japan by launching discs that depicted the image of a dam to go on top of its instant noodle product which consumers could use when draining the hot water.

Summary statement

The ultimate undertaking to change "annoying" into "exciting".

The goal was to implement a project that could be picked up by local news or social media. In doing so, we hoped to further satisfy our core Nissin Yakisoba U.F.O. consumers and strengthen the image of Nissin's e-commerce website. We began the manufacture and sale of original food-safe discs depicting the image of a dam that could be affixed to the U.F.O. containers.
